Conversations focus on the intersection of faith and everyday life, featuring heartfelt discussions among hosts and a range of guests. The hosts share personal experiences, encouraging listeners to navigate issues such as identity, motherhood, friendships, and mental health through the lens of Christianity. The episodes emphasize the importance of genuine connections and finding one's identity in Christ, along with practical insights for balancing spiritual growth amid daily challenges. Notably, the emphasis on vulnerability, community support, and the healing power of prayer sets this podcast apart as an uplifting resource for listeners seeking encouragement and practical faith-based guidance.
